Biography

Hilary Krase is a member of the firm’s complex business litigation group.

Hilary has been a member of numerous trial teams, including serving as first chair in a recent jury trial, and has practiced before both federal and state courts as well as in arbitration. Hilary routinely represents clients in shareholder and intra-company disputes, real estate disputes, and antitrust matters. She also advises and litigates in the area of governmental and municipal law both at the trial and appellate level.

Hilary’s practice includes an appellate component, through which she has represented clients before the Ninth Circuit and Federal Circuit as well as the California Court of Appeal. She has also authored several amici briefs both in state and federal court, including recently in the United States Supreme Court.

Hilary prides herself on her attention to detail and her enthusiasm for research. She works with clients from the inception of the case to tell a story, whether it be through pleadings, oral argument, or ultimately trial.

Prior to joining Farella Braun + Martel, Hilary clerked for the Honorable Jesus G. Bernal of the Central District of California. During law school, she externed for the Honorable William Alsup of the Northern District of California.
